Shillong, Jun 10: The Shillong Sports Association’s U-20 Fourth Division 2025 will begin on 14th June, according to revised fixtures sent out yesterday.
The league was meant to begin on 2nd June but had to be postponed due to necessary work on the drainage at the SSA Stadium in Polo.
Twenty-nine clubs have completed the registration process and they have been divided into six groups of five, except for Group F, which has four teams.
Matches will be of 80 minutes’ duration and will all be held at the SSA Stadium at First Ground, Polo.
The top two teams from each group will progress to the next round, which will see four groups of three teams each. From here, the best two teams from each group will qualify for the knockout stage, with quarterfinals followed by semifinals and final.
The four teams that reach the semifinals will be promoted to the Third Division in 2026. In another change, the team with the lowest number of points from each group will be barred from taking part in the U-20 Fourth Division next year.
